- List your business on Google Maps.
To list your business on Google Maps, you need to make a Google Business Profile and verify it. To do this, follow these steps:
-
Go to Google Business Profile to get your business listed on Google.
-
Enter your business name to proceed with the process.
-
Choose your business type: Online retail, Local store, or Service business.
-
Then, you can add your business category or the industry that your business is included in.
-
Next is to enter your business address. This is important because pinning your store will depend on the location of your business that you will indicate here.
-
According to the location that you have indicated in your business address, you can now pin your exact location in Google Maps. Take note that Google will still have to check this, so your store will only be visible after the verification process.
-
Next would be the contact details that you would want to share to your customers that would view your business from Google. To assist new customers in finding your place, you can indicate your business contacts, such as phone number and website link.
-
You can verify your store by either entering the code sent to your mailing address or provide Google with a video showing your store.
-
After passing verification, add your services and business hours.
- Provide a customized Google review link.
To create a short and precise link for your Google reviews,
-
Go to the Google Maps Platform.
-
Scroll down to Map actions and under Parameters.
-
Look for the linked text of place ID and click it.
-
After being navigated to the Place IDs page, scroll down to find the ID of a particular page.
-
Click the search bar and search for the name of your business that you have listed on Google Maps.
-
Click the name of your business store and it should show the place ID, then you will copy and paste it on bitly Google Review Link Generator.
-
After shortening and simplifying the link, test it, then it should be ready for dissemination.
- Ask customers for a review.
If you have a physical or online store, it is necessary that you still ask customers for a review. For physical stores, you can personally encourage store visitors to leave a review on your Google review by printing a QR code of your Google review link near the counter or the store’s door. On the other hand, online store business owners may disseminate an email automating tool to send multiple review invitations at once. You can also encourage the people to visit your website because it is easy to navigate in an online platform. If possible, add a personal touch and explain the importance of their review to the business that you have established. It is also crucial to give gratitude to the people who have added reviews on your Google business store so that they can commend the service that they have experienced from your business.

- Add your Google review link in your email signature.
To add a Google review link in your Email signature, follow these steps:
-
Go to Google Mail Settings.
-
Under General, look for the Signature section.
-
Click “Create new” and type in “Leave a review here.” or anything that indicates leaving a review.
-
A rich text editor will show after this. Click the Link button.

- After clicking the Link button, edit the Text to display to “Google Reviews” and enter the URL link of your customized Google review link that you had created in the third bullet (Provide a customized Google review link.).

- After clicking “OK”, every Email will now be sent with the signature indicating your Google review link.
- Create a QR code for your Google review link.
Creating a QR code is an easy step to disseminate your Google reviews on your physical stores. To create one, follow the steps below:
-
Go to qr-code-generator.com.
-
Enter your customized Google review link in the space provided.
-
You can see the finished QR code on the right side.
-
Edit it out with frames, shape, color, or you can customize it by adding your logo.
-
Click “Download” in JPG format.
Generating a QR code allows you to display your Google review link on marketing posters so that your customers can leave a review by scanning them because it is easier to scan the QR code using the built-in QR scanner from their devices.
